Post Malone Covers Country Songs, Proves He Can Do It All
March 23, 2021
On Sunday, Post Malone performed for Matthew McConaughey's "We’re Texas" virtual benefit concert to help raise money for victims of the Texas snowstorm.
But Post Malone didn't perform his own songs. Since it was for Texas, he showed his versatility and covered two country songs: Brad Paisley's "I’m Gonna Miss Her" and Sturgill Simpson's "You Can Have The Crown".
Both fans of Post Malone and fans of country music loved the covers.
"This dude can sing anything, love how he sounds on country music," one person commented.
"Post is a modern day ROCKSTAR. this man can do it all," another wrote.
